TWATS or T.W.A.T.S military type jargon acronym for The War Against Terrorist Supremecy. Often used by those wanker journalsts, who are fond of using terms like 9/11, WTC, ACM and IED and 'The Sandpit', to establish some 'cred' for themselves.
Oh yeah, I've been following TWATS since before 9/11. The use of IED's by ACM has certainly increased in 'The Sandpit', since then.
by anonimouse October 28, 2006

1) Name for a pregnant female Goldfish
2) Female Genetalia
3) A person of highly annoying capability
2) Female Genetalia
3) A person of highly annoying capability
by ODBall3r January 6, 2007

by Akoda November 1, 2019

by McSplooge June 5, 2016

A very British insult.
by hugenonce69 June 8, 2019

by TwistedSis20 July 27, 2020
